2. Asset Valuation
Determining an individual's net worth hinges significantly on accurately assessing assets. Asset valuation is a crucial element in calculating Jenicka Rivera's financial standing. This process involves determining the monetary worth of various possessions, investments, and holdings, ultimately contributing to the overall picture of her wealth.
- Real Estate Valuation
Assessing the market value of properties, including homes and other real estate holdings, is a critical step. Factors like location, size, condition, and comparable sales in the area influence the evaluation. Variations in property types (residential, commercial) further complicate valuation. Accurate appraisal of real estate holdings provides a substantial component of net worth calculation.
- Investment Portfolio Valuation
Investment holdings, such as stocks, bonds, and mutual funds, require careful valuation. Market fluctuations, the current financial climate, and the specific portfolio composition affect the overall worth. Professional investment advisors or financial analysts often calculate the total value of a portfolio. The value of these investments is a critical piece of the calculation for Jenicka Rivera's net worth.
- Personal Property Valuation
Valuing personal property, such as vehicles, artwork, jewelry, and other collectibles, involves considering various factors, including condition, rarity, historical significance, and current market trends. Different valuation methods apply depending on the type of personal property. Accurate assessment of these items provides a comprehensive view of accumulated wealth.
- Liquid Asset Valuation
Cash in bank accounts, savings accounts, and readily available investment funds constitute liquid assets. Determining the precise figures of these accounts is straightforward. The level of liquid assets directly impacts liquidity and financial flexibility.

4. Investment Returns
Investment returns play a crucial role in shaping an individual's overall net worth. The success of investments directly impacts the accumulation of wealth over time. For figures like Jenicka Rivera, successful investment strategies are significant contributors to a burgeoning financial portfolio. This section explores the connection between investment returns and an individual's net worth.
- Types of Investments
Investment strategies encompass a range of options, including stocks, bonds, real estate, and other ventures. The specific types of investments chosen influence potential returns, and the associated risk levels vary considerably. Diversification across different investment types helps mitigate risk. A well-diversified portfolio may be more resilient to market fluctuations, a critical consideration when evaluating the impact on net worth.
- Return on Investment (ROI) Calculation
Investment returns are typically calculated as a percentage of the initial investment. Measuring ROI helps assess the profitability of various investment choices. Higher ROI values over time contribute more significantly to overall net worth growth. The frequency and consistency of positive returns are significant factors. For individuals with established investment portfolios, a detailed analysis of ROI across different asset classes informs strategic decisions.
- Impact of Market Conditions
Market conditions heavily influence investment returns. Economic downturns can negatively affect investment valuations, potentially leading to lower returns or even losses. Conversely, periods of market growth often result in higher returns. The individual's investment strategy and risk tolerance play pivotal roles in navigating market fluctuations. Understanding the sensitivity of investments to market forces is critical for managing and preserving net worth, especially for individuals with substantial financial assets.
- Investment Time Horizon
The timeframe for holding investments significantly impacts the potential returns. Long-term investments often present opportunities for higher returns but carry higher risk. The appropriateness of investment strategies depends on the individual's long-term financial objectives and risk tolerance. The relationship between investment returns and the time horizon is essential to effectively manage the long-term net worth.
